GIANT SET-UP

Click to enlarge Click to enlarge

Since the Ogres were attacking the Giant camp by surprise, Nathan had very little space to deploy his Giants. The scenario gives the Giant player only a 12" x 12" area in the centre of the 6' wide table edge.

Nathan placed his four Giants as close to Dave's Ogres as possible. He did, however, face his leftmost and rightmost Giants slightly askew. This placement may have tipped Dave off to Nathan's plan and affected Dave's deployment.

OGRES SET-UP

Click to enlarge Click to enlarge

Dave set up a large portion of his Ogre army on the right flank and allocated none of his units to the left. His right side was led by his Bruiser general, a unit of three Bulls, and a block of Gnoblars, twenty strong.

Dave deployed his remaining Ogres along the main table edge. Maneaters, Ironguts, and a deadly Hunter protected this board edge from any Giants wishing the flee the scene from this outlet.
